Q1.
 What is the difference between human hair and synthetic hair ?
A: Synthetic Hair: Burning smells like a burning plastic, there is a small flame, and feels viscous when it burns out .
Human Hair: Burning smells like a burnt fragrance, human hair burns out very quickly, and feels like coke. It also becomes ash easily.

Q3. What is natural color ?
A: Natural color is the tone of virgin hair. It gradual changes from 1b off black to #2 dark brown.
 
Q4. What is difference between Yaki straight and Silky Straight ?
A: There are many small curls of Yaki hair and it feels coarse. Silky straight is very straight, silky and smooth.

Q6. What do “Free part” “middle part” and “three part”mean ?
A: Free part closure means free parting and you can part your hair anywhere by yourself.
Middle part means it is parted in the middle, but you can still part your hair anywhere .
Three parts are combined with visible middle parting, left parting and right parting that we made in advance, so you can switch parting very easy .
 
Q7. What is the parting space for your lace wigs ?
A: The parting depth is usually 3inch from the front to back.
 
Q8. What is lace front wig?
A: Lace front wig is associated with both handmade and machine made. The front(Common size 13x4inch, 13x6inch) is hand knitted and the back is machined weft. It has the advantage of both natural looking and economical compare to full lace wig.
 
Q9. What is full lace wig?
A: Full Lace Wig is a lace wig that human hairs are all ventilated on French lace, Swiss lace, PU or other bases. So it is all handmade work and more expensive, but it looks very natural. You can part your hair anywhere as you want and wear high ponytail.
 
Q10. What is lace closure?
A: Hair closure also called top closure is actually a small hairpiece which is usually used to match weave on style. According to different base material, hair closure is generally classified into lace closure and silk closure. The common size of lace closure is 4x4inch, 5x5inch, 6x6inch.
 
Q10. What is lace frontal?
A: You can treat lace frontal a even bigger size closure, it covers the front head from ear to ear, so the length is usually 13inch, and the depth is 2inch, 4inch or 6inch, thus the size will be 13x2inch, 13x4inch, 13x6inch.
 
Q11. What is hair weave /weft ?
A: Hair weave/weft extensions are wefts of human hair sewn on to a flat track. They are typically associated with braid weaves to make one's hair appear thicker or longer.
 
Q12. What is clip in hair extension?
A:Clip in hair extension is a temporary extension that can be quickly applied.One pack of clip in contains several weft hair pieces with some clips attached. Clip-ins can be worn all day and all night; however, they must be removed before sleeping.
 
Q13. What is micro loop hair extension?
A: Micro Loop Extension is also called Micro Link or Micro bead extension. It is a strand by strand technique attached to your own hair using tiny links, locks or shells that can match hair color or be clear.
Q14. Do I need to wash my hair before wearing it ?
A: Our hair is very clean and neatly , so you don’t have to wash your hair at first when you receive it. For curly hair we don’t recommend you to wash because it may ruin the curly pattern.
 
Q15. Can I straighten my curly hair ?
A: We don’t recommend to straighten curly hair because it may cause hair problems like shedding and tangle. So had better remain the same curly look.
 
Q16. Can I dye my curly hair?
A: For virgin hair you can dye it, but curly hair is not easy to operate by yourself, so please let a professional stylist help you and don’t do that yourself. For Malaysian and Indian hair we don’t recommend you to dye.
 
Q17. How to maintain my curly hair ?
A: 1. Choose a shampoo and conditioner that suit to your hair type. Curly or coarse hair probably needs frizz-minimizing and softening shampoo. Colored or treated hair probably needs a shampoo that's fortified with extracts or amino acids.
2. Proper way to deep condition curly hair.
Deep condition at least once a week with cold water. Apply moderate the conditioner starting about an inch down from the root all the way down to the tips of your hair,Wait about 15 minutes before rinsing, then use a wide toothed comb working up from the tips to the roots so your hair.
3. Proper way to blow-dried curly hair
After washed the hair, towel off your hair slightly, just enough to stop the dripping. Don't rub your hair with the towel. Start blow drying at the top/roots, about six inches away from your scalp with low-temperature setting. Work your way down and leave your hair a little bit damp. (Tips: If you want some lift and volume, use your hands to comb your roots up and blow-dry).
4. Styling curly hair
Shape the hair by scrunching it some more and twirling pieces around a finger. Avoid using brushes and narrow-toothed combs and avoid touching your hair as much as possible.This can separate your curls and lead to unwanted frizz. Don’t straighten curly hair because it may cause hair problems like shedding and tangle.
Color hair with a professional stylist help.
 
Q18. How to care for my hair? Any suggestions ?
A: 1. Co-Wash your Hair.Co-wash hair with a conditioner at least once a week. Using cold water to make it shinier, lock in moisture,reduce frizz.
2. Blow-dried and don’t let it air-dried. The longer the hair swelling goes on, the more pressure it puts on the delicate proteins keeping hair intact, which can lead to more damage.
3. Seal your wefts or knots before hair install. Seal wefts or knots will prevent shedding and make hair tight. Please applying the sealant to both sides of the weft.
4. Use Wide Toothed Comb. After you shower try using a wide toothed comb. Or use your fingers rather than a brush.
5. Protect the hair from heat. Use a heat protectant spray, oil or serum when you use heating tools.
6. Tips To Root. When take your comb, brush, or fingers & start at the tips of your hair and work your way up to the root (weft ) of hair.
7. Deep Condition. After several installation, a deep condition is necessary. Good conditioner or deep conditioner is need. Try shampoos that do not contain sulfates or parabens.
8. Wrap It Up. Remember to twist, braid, bantu-knot, flexi-rod, roller set,rod set,or wrap your hair before sleep.
9. Don’t swim in the Sea. When your hair is installed which may make your hair dry and tangle badly.
 
Q19. What is bleached knots ?
A: Bleached knots help make the hair appear as if it is growing from the scalp. When hair is tied to the lace, there is a dark knot where the hair is secured. Bleaching or "lightening" the knots reduces the visibility of this knot. On off black (1B) and dark brown hair, the knots are lightened to a light brown shade. Very light brown and blonde and shades usually do not need bleached knots. It is not possible to bleach knots on jet black (#1) hair, and is very difficult to bleach knots on 1B hair.
 
Q20. What is the glueless wig cap?
A: On glueless caps there are combs on it, to avoid the wig slip down. Also at back there is an adjustable strap you can adjust it to fit you well.
 
Q21. What is silk top?
A: Silk top is made by 3 layer lace, the knots are hidden in the middle of the 2 layer lace, the hair looked like it rise from the scalp.
